Suicide Squad: James Gunn Continues Teasing King Shark In New Photo


Admit it, you want to see King Shark in The Suicide Squad. Not surprisingly, James Gunn knows this and that's why he simply won't stop teasing about the DC supervillain being in his upcoming film.

Gunn recently posted a series of photos showing a special arcade created by Microsoft for the cast and crew of Suicide Squad. Interestingly, the arcade is called the "King Sharkade" and it's just as awesome as it sounds. Make sure to swipe through to view all the pictures.

"Many thanks to the lovely folks from @microsoft who set us up with a #KingSharkade for the cast and crew's downtime during pre-production and production on #TheSuicideSquad," Gunn wrote.

This isn't the first time that Gunn teased fans with some surprisingly wholesome King Shark content on social media. The Guardians of the Galaxy director previously shared images of two King Shark-themed cakes that were given to him on his birthday.

But who will play King Shark in The Suicide Squad? That is still a mystery although there were speculations that Gunn had cast frequent collaborator Michael Rooker as Nanaue. Either way, we're certainly looking forward to seeing King Shark soon.

The Suicide Squad is expected to begin filming in September. The film is then scheduled for release on August 6, 2021.
